Peter operated on our new dog Molly on Wednesday. We have only had her a couple of weeks and, at four years old, had been used for breeding. She came with a chronic urinary infection and her teeth c... Read More
Peter operated on our new dog Molly on Wednesday. We have only had her a couple of weeks and, at four years old, had been used for breeding. She came with a chronic urinary infection and her teeth covered in plaque with putrid breath. Peter speyed her, did a full dental with an extraction, nails etc. He did a brilliant job at a very competitive price. Read Less

Really nice people but pets are not their main focus - money is! I was short of money by 24hrs and they refused to see my dog for an eye infection (excessive discharge and his eye is closing)! It's no... Read More
Really nice people but pets are not their main focus - money is! I was short of money by 24hrs and they refused to see my dog for an eye infection (excessive discharge and his eye is closing)! It's not like they would have gone bankrupt if they didn't receive payment today so now my boy has to suffer for another day. Surely the health of the animal should come before the pound signs?! Once he has been prescribed the really expensive medication needed I'm registering him elsewhere where money isn't the main object. I feel extremely let down and don't know how these so called vets sleep at night!Read Less
